What’s a Registered Agent
A registered agent acts as a designated person or organization that is tasked with receiving legal documents on behalf of a company. This role is crucial for making sure that a business remains compliant with state regulations. Registered agents are usually required for LLCs and corporations, functioning as the primary point of contact for legal notifications, tax notices, and various official correspondence.
When starting a company, selecting a dependable registered agent is important for upholding a positive status with the state. The registered agent must have a tangible address within the state where the business is registered, and they must be present during standard business hours to accept crucial documents. This service can be provided by an person or a dedicated registered agent company, ensuring that the business owner stays informed of all legal concerns that come up.
In besides official notifications, a registered agent aids business compliance by aiding in making certain that annual filings and additional necessary documentation are filed on time. This aspect of compliance is essential for keeping the firm's legal status and avoiding penalties. Legal Prerequisites for Designated Representatives
To operate as a registered representative, certain lawful prerequisites must be met, which can vary by state. Generally, a registered agent must be a inhabitant of the jurisdiction in which the business is formed or a corporate entity licensed to conduct operations in that jurisdiction. This ensures that there is a dependable point of communication for legal and official documents. The registered agent must also be reachable during standard business times to accept crucial communications and delivery of legal proceedings.
In furthermore to residency, registered representatives have a duty to ensure compliance with state laws. This includes keeping their designated office location up to current and ensuring that they can be reached by postal service and in physical presence. Inability to satisfy these requirements can result in penalties, including possible dissolution of the company. Responsibilities of a Registered Agent
A designated representative plays a critical role in ensuring the legal compliance of a company. One of their primary responsibilities is to receive and manage important legal documents on behalf of the business. This entails notifications of legal actions, official government communications, and other critical documents. By acting as a point of contact, the registered agent ensures that the company stays updated about its legal obligations and any actions that may need to be taken.
Another important responsibility of a registered agent is to make certain that the business remains compliant with local regulations. This includes keeping track of due dates for annual reports, franchise taxes, and other required documentation required by the local government. Failure to meet these obligations can lead to penalties, late fees, or even the dissolution of the business. Therefore, having a dependable registered agent helps in complying with legal requirements and maintaining good standing with government agencies.
